Transaction 893b9f2903a3f950559992dc08ffd2cb22a93581dc833b58d1fb561ba4624a2e

2 Input
2 Outputs
  • 893b9f2903a3f950559992dc08ffd2cb22a93581dc833b58d1fb561ba4624a2e:0
  • value  2476130
    address  3MGfyBXAiYRJ8xZuVsp9wLjYHCoZ1XemgC
  • 893b9f2903a3f950559992dc08ffd2cb22a93581dc833b58d1fb561ba4624a2e:1
  • value  16024000
    address  18gmeLSJDNbuCCAfmTuaAstf1Cegak3wE9